Code for How to Add a TLS/SSL Certificate in Python Code Tutorial

basic_request.py

import requests

response = requests.get('https://www.google.com')
print(response.status_code)

add_simple_cert.py

import requests

response = requests.get('https://www.google.com', verify='/path/to/certificate.pem')
print(response.status_code)

self_signed.py

import requests

response = requests.get('https://self-signed.badssl.com/', verify='our-cert.pem')
print(response.status_code)

client_auth.py

import requests

# make a request to the server that require the client to provide a certificate for mutual auth
response = requests.get('https://client.badssl.com/', cert=('our-cert.pem', 'our-key.pem'))
print(response.status_code)


🕒 Limited-Time Offer!
EBook Image

Web Security Week Special! Get our Cybersecurity eBook Bundle at 40% off. Limited time only!

$68.0 $40.8